In order to complete a convection current, the rising material must eventually sink Earth.

Convection is a process in which hotter, less dense material rises and colder, denser material sinks. This transfer of heat through the movement of fluid is driven by the tendency of warmer material to rise and cooler material to sink under the influence of gravity.

For example, in the Earth's mantle, convection currents drive plate tectonics by causing the upward flow of warmer material and the slow downward sinking of cooler material.

When temperature differences exist, hot liquids rise and cold liquids sink. This creates convection currents. Convection currents transfer heat through the fluidity of water, air, or even hot magma. Convection currents develop when heated fluids expand. These fluids become less dense. The decrease in density causes the fluid to rise away from the original heat source. As the fluid rises, colder fluid is pulled toward the heat source and replaces the warm fluid. This fluid is then heated. It rises, and the process begins again. Convection currents establish a circular current that only ceases once the heat is evenly transferred throughout the fluid.
